// isTarballNotFoundError reports whether err indicates that the backup tarball
// does not exist in object storage (e.g. HTTP 404 / not-found). Such errors are
// permanent and not retryable, so callers should let deletion proceed (skipping
// DeleteItemAction plugins) rather than failing the entire deletion.
//
// Transient errors (throttling, auth failures, network timeouts) return false so
// the deletion is failed and can be retried once the storage is reachable again.
func isTarballNotFoundError(err error) bool {
if err == nil {
return false
}
// Lower-case once for all comparisons.
msg := strings.ToLower(err.Error())
// Common "not found" indicators across cloud providers:
// - "not found" / "does not exist": generic, in-memory object store
// - "nosuchkey": AWS S3
// - "blobnotfound": Azure Blob Storage
// - "objectnotexist": GCS
return strings.Contains(msg, "not found") ||
strings.Contains(msg, "does not exist") ||
strings.Contains(msg, "nosuchkey") ||
strings.Contains(msg, "blobnotfound") ||
strings.Contains(msg, "objectnotexist")
}
